RE-Thinking of (MODU) Jack-up Raising Systems

By James E. Ingle P.E.

Virtually all jack-up Mobile Offshore Drilling Units (MODU) built in the last forty years
have used rack and pinion drives to raise and lower their drilling platforms. As these
jack-up drilling units have become more massive these raising systems have
reached their practical limit and re-thinking of the raising and lowering systems for
jack-ups is mandatory before larger rigs are designed for deeper water depths.
Even though great strides have been made in the design and refinement of rack
and pinion drives, it is impossible to overcome the extremely high stress between
the spur gear and the rack and the unequal loading of the multiple spur gears with
the present designs. By using new computer technology coupled with old proven
methods, hydraulic cylinders, a new jack-up jacking system has been envisioned
which overcomes the inherent problems of the present jacking systems.
